Recurve Sight Parts - SHIBUYA

2 product(s) found
View:
Sort by:
SHIBUYA ULTIMA SIGHT PARTS
Item No. A032420
5 article(s)
Shibuya
SHIBUYA SIGHT PARTS RC PRO KNURLED SIGHT PIN KNOB
Item No. A082079 Out of stock
Shibuya 54010
€ 16,00
    Loading
    Loading